Beispiel für die Methode java.util.TreeSet.descendingSet()
In diesem Artikel erfahren Sie, wie Sie ein TreeSet in absteigender Reihenfolge sortieren, indem Sie die java.util.TreeSet.descendingSet().Die Methode descendingSet() wird verwendet, um eine Ansicht der in diesem Set enthaltenen Elemente in umgekehrter Reihenfolge zurückzugeben. Die absteigende Reihenfolge des Satzes wird von dieser Methode zurückgegeben.
Dieses Beispiel zeigt die Implementierung des descendingSet():
import java.util.Iterator;Nachdem dieser Code kompiliert und ausgeführt wurde, geschieht Folgendes in der Ausgabe:
import java.util.TreeSet;
public class Tri_decroissant {
public static void main(String[] args) {
// Erstellen eines TreeSet
TreeSettset = new TreeSet ();
TreeSettsetreverse = new TreeSet ();
// Elemente hinzufügen
tset.add(10);
tset.add(3);
tset.add(18);
tset.add(7);
// Erstellen des inversen tsetreverse
tsetreverse=(TreeSet)tset.descendingSet();
// in absteigender Reihenfolge durchsuchen
Iterator-Iterator = tsetreverse.iterator();
// Daten aus TreeSet anzeigen
System.out.println("TreeSet-Elemente in absteigender Reihenfolge: ");
while (iterator.hasNext()){
System.out.println(iterator.next() + " ");
}
}
}
TreeSet-Elemente in absteigender Reihenfolge:Reference:
18
10
7
3
Javadoc: descendingSet() TreeSet-Methode